Kinds Of Car Keys
Before diving into the replacement process, it is necessary to understand the different kinds of car keys. Each key type has its unique characteristics and requirements for duplication:
Key TypeDescriptionConventional KeyA simple metal key that unlocks the door and starts the engine.Transponder KeyA key with a chip that communicates with the car’s ignition system.Smart Key/ Key FobA keyless entry remote that enables for proximity starting and unlocking.Laser-Cut KeyA key with a distinct style cut by a laser, typically utilized in more recent models.
Comprehending the type of key is essential for the subsequent steps included in getting a replacement.

Cost of Car Replacement Keys
The expense of getting a car replacement key can vary considerably based on various factors, including:
Key Type: Traditional keys generally cost less than transponder or smart keys.Provider: Dealerships normally charge more than locksmith professionals or key replacement services.Configuring Fees: If your key needs programming, additional expenses may apply.
Approximated Costs:
